This PR beefs up the watchdog on the Crumbcart kiosk app. Previously it only checked the UI heartbeat; now it also watches the payment bridge and restarts the whole stack if either stalls. Added jittered backoff so a flapping kiosk doesn't reboot-loop itself into oblivion. Should be safe to ship mid-week. The timeouts and thresholds it uses are below.

tuning table, hafog-bahaf:
QUOTAS = {
    "praion": 144,
    "briax": 906,
    "silwyn": 451,
}

After the Havermill fleet schema has been copied to the new Drosselbank cluster, the nightly fuel-usage report for TransKorva Logistics must be repointed. Verify first that the `fuel_ledger` and `vehicle_odometer` tables both pass row-count parity checks; the report silently truncates on partial data, which burned us during the Pellworth migration. Update the report runner's config under `reports/fleet/`, keeping the old entry commented out for one release cycle. The new target cluster is reached with the following connection string.

warehouse DSN: mssql://rusdor_svc:0FSWCn9@db-951a.paliqforge.local:5432/ulawyn

**Alert: shrinkwand-batch-failure-rate**

Fires when the Shrinkwand CLI's nightly batch resize job reports more than 2% failed images. Usually caused by corrupt uploads or an exhausted temp volume on the worker box. Check disk first, then the failure manifest. Triage steps and known failure signatures are documented on the internal page.

runbook for badug-kadup: https://confluence.zemvarlabs.internal/projects/browse/display/projects/bd1b

Runbook 7.3 — Quarterly stock-count ledger run. Heads up, dispatch: the ledger for Brindlewood depot goes out the last Friday of the quarter, no exceptions. Use the grey lockbag, double-tag it, and log the seal number before it leaves the cage. Pickup is by Torvane Couriers. The confidential hand-over instruction for the courier appears just below.

courier memo of tawep-tajep: the quenius ulaiel courier leaves the fenir ledger at gate 9128 under passcode 527513